Birthing Luz was founded by Andrea Carrasco, RN, ICCE, an experienced labor and delivery nurse, certified childbirth educator, mother, and passionate advocate for evidence-based, physiologic birth.
The name Birthing Luz was inspired by the Spanish phrase dando a luz—"giving birth," which literally translates to "giving light." Every birth welcomes new light into the world, and every family deserves to begin that journey feeling informed, supported, and confident.
Andrea created Birthing Luz to bridge the gap between medical knowledge and practical preparation. After caring for hundreds of laboring families in the hospital, she saw firsthand that education can transform the birth experience. Understanding how labor works, what options are available, and how to navigate the hospital setting allows families to approach birth with greater confidence and peace of mind.
As both a labor and delivery nurse and childbirth educator, Andrea offers a unique perspective that combines clinical expertise with compassionate, personalized teaching. She specializes in physiologic birth and helping families understand how to support the natural process of labor while also preparing for the realities of giving birth in today's healthcare system. Her goal is never to promote one "right" way to give birth, but to equip families with evidence-based knowledge so they can make informed decisions that align with their values and circumstances.
Andrea is fluent in English, Spanish, and Portuguese, allowing her to educate and support families from diverse backgrounds.
